How to Conduct an Effective SEO Audit
To carry out a comprehensive SEO audit, one must systematically assess the numerous factors that affect a website's performance in search engines. The procedure starts by assessing the site's technical foundation, guaranteeing that it is accessible to users and search engines equally. Aspects like site speed, mobile responsiveness, and secure connections play critical roles in overall effectiveness.
Furthermore, content quality must be carefully evaluated, focusing on relevance, keyword optimization, and originality. Reviewing user interaction metrics helps reveal how well content resonates with visitors.
Additionally, evaluating link profiles and domain strength is crucial for determining a web presence's competitive standing and credibility. Detecting broken links and refining meta tags additionally improve the domain's search visibility.
Finally, utilizing analytics tools to track and monitor performance supports sustained progress. A thorough audit not only pinpoints weaknesses but also exposes opportunities for advancement, thereby improving the visibility and effectiveness of a website in search engine results.

Technical SEO Overview
A comprehensive technical SEO framework is critical for detecting and addressing challenges that might affect a site's effectiveness in search engine rankings. Key components include evaluating site speed, confirming mobile compatibility, and confirming HTTPS protocols. Furthermore, proper URL structures and optimized XML sitemaps facilitate better indexing by search engines. Website owners should identify broken links and establish redirects where appropriate to improve the user experience. Making sure robots.txt files are properly set up avoids inadvertently restricting important content. Additionally, structured data implementation boosts search presence by giving search engines meaningful context. Carrying out consistent technical SEO evaluations helps webmasters preserve top-level performance and keep an edge in competitive online environments.

Leading Tools for Your WordPress SEO Audit
Performing a comprehensive SEO audit for a WordPress site demands the appropriate tools to identify opportunities for improvement and boost search performance. Critical tools encompass Google Analytics, which tracks user behavior and traffic sources, helping identify effective content. Furthermore, Google Search Console remains essential for overseeing site health and comprehending how search engines index the site.
Search engine optimization plugins like Yoast SEO and All in One SEO Pack deliver real-time optimization feedback, guaranteeing content meets best practices. For technical audits, tools such as Screaming Frog SEO Spider are able to examine site architecture and detect broken links or missing metadata. Additionally, SEMrush and Ahrefs offer extensive keyword analysis and competitor insights, vital for enhancing SEO approaches. By utilizing these tools, webmasters can acquire actionable data, thereby enhancing their site's visibility and performance in search engine results.
SEO Audit: Critical Missteps to Watch Out For
When carrying out an SEO review, a large number of site owners tend to miss common pitfalls that may compromise their efforts. A significant oversight is overlooking the need to check the web page's mobile optimization. With rising mobile user activity, a website that lacks mobile optimization can experience ranking drops. In addition, neglecting to evaluate site speed can lead to a subpar user experience and elevated bounce rates.
Another typical mistake is disregarding the value of URL structure. Clean, descriptive URLs promote stronger indexing and enhance user understanding. Furthermore, several audits fail to address the evaluation of on-page search elements, such as page titles and meta descriptions, which are essential for search engine performance.
Finally, webmasters tend to concentrate exclusively on technical aspects without considering the quality of their content. High-quality, relevant content is essential for attracting and retaining visitors and enhancing search engine rankings. Preventing these common errors can considerably boost the performance of an SEO audit, producing more successful optimization outcomes.

What Are the Prices for Professional SEO Audit Services?
The price of professional SEO audit services can differ significantly, usually spanning from $500 to several thousand dollars. Variables that impact the pricing include the complexity of the website, the depth of analysis required, and the expertise of the service provider. Smaller websites are often associated with lesser expenses, while bigger or more sophisticated sites commonly demand detailed audits, see now contributing to increased costs. Clients should assess their needs and budget accordingly before selecting a service.
How Much Time Does an SEO Audit Usually Take?
The duration of an SEO audit usually spans anywhere between a few hours and several days, subject to the intricacy of the site and the thoroughness of the evaluation demanded. In the case of smaller sites, a standard audit is often wrapped up in one to three hours, though more extensive or complicated sites might demand a week or more for an in-depth review. Being thorough is critical, as it guarantees that all aspects of SEO are adequately assessed and addressed.
